Transaction 5fd5f5900f5d7ff31d2c51835b6b368eadc70c19309a72eebd73ed95431eb777

3 Input
1 Outputs
  • 5fd5f5900f5d7ff31d2c51835b6b368eadc70c19309a72eebd73ed95431eb777:0
  • value  37816007
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G